Output e1aaef6ad6e5e1cbd710cc49d215a41d9cebd046bb1c9d883462c342a51ec26d:1

value
2071466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87fef2515cb9282ee9d3dad6a05cb6edf5c5cd38 OP_EQUAL
address
3E66ZSMcagNKnyvdvoZeTKikhxSFjjuhii
transaction
e1aaef6ad6e5e1cbd710cc49d215a41d9cebd046bb1c9d883462c342a51ec26d
confirmations
380966
spent
true